Combat Perimenopause and Menopause Fatigue Naturally: Hormonal Harmony

Navigating the shifts of perimenopause and menopause can feel like a wild ride. Energy levels may swing, leaving you feeling weary. But fear not! There are powerful ways to restore hormonal harmony and reclaim your energy.

A holistic approach that utilizes both lifestyle adjustments and natural remedies can make a world of difference.

Here are some key strategies to consider:

* Prioritize quality sleep. Targeting 7-8 hours per night can help regulate your hormones and leave you feeling refreshed.

* Nourish your body with a wholesome diet rich in fruits, vegetables, and complex carbohydrates. Limit processed foods, sugary drinks, and caffeine, which can exacerbate fatigue.

* Engage in regular exercise. Even moderate activities like walking or yoga can boost energy levels and improve well-being.

* Explore the benefits of herbal remedies such as black cohosh, which may help alleviate menopausal symptoms and promote hormonal balance.

Speak with your doctor before making any significant changes to your health routine, especially if you have underlying health concerns.

By taking a proactive approach to your well-being and embracing these natural strategies, you can navigate the challenges of perimenopause and menopause while feeling your best.

Restore Your Energy: Natural Remedies for Menopause Symptoms

Menopause can be a challenging transition, often leaving women to experience fatigue and a decline in energy levels. Luckily, there are natural ways to combat these symptoms and reclaim your vitality. One of the top natural boosters for menopausal energy is regular exercise. Even moderate physical activity can boost energy levels, improve mood, and reduce stress.

Another vital factor is getting sleep. Aim for 6-8 of quality sleep each night to rejuvenate your body and mind. Furthermore, a balanced diet can make a world of difference. Prioritize whole foods like fruits, vegetables, lean proteins, and healthy fats, while reducing processed foods, sugar, and caffeine.

Moreover, certain supplements may be effective.

  • Consult a healthcare professional regarding options like vitamin D, B vitamins, and iron.
  • Herbal remedies such as ginseng or maca root may also provide an energy boost.

By incorporating these natural strategies, you can efficiently manage menopausal fatigue and feel a renewed sense of vitality.
